Exploring the Philosophical ​Depths of Westworlds ⁢Narrative Arc

The‌ intricate‌ narrative of ⁢*Westworld* invites​ viewers to ‍ponder the essence of consciousness and⁤ the moral implications of artificial intelligence. Throughout⁤ its ‌four-season tenure, the series deftly weaves themes of free will, identity, and ⁣the nature of reality, creating a tapestry ⁣that‌ is as⁣ thought-provoking‍ as⁣ it is ‌engaging.‍ As ⁤the hosts evolve from mere programmed entities to ‍beings grappling with their own existence, audiences are ⁣confronted with the ⁢question: What⁣ does ⁢it ⁣mean to​ be truly ​alive? The philosophical‍ underpinnings of ⁣the narrative arc​ challenge our understanding of humanity, urging us ‌to​ reflect on the choices we make and⁣ the underlying ‍motivations behind them.

Each season serves ​as a layered exploration of ​these themes, using a rich blend of ⁣character development and complex storytelling. Key motifs emerge throughout, including:

  • The‌ Illusion of Choice: Characters repeatedly face the paradox of being crafted by ‍others while striving for autonomy.
  • Reality vs. ⁣Simulation: ​The ​blurred lines between⁢ the ‍physical and ‌the ⁤programmed forces viewers ​to consider their own perceptions of truth.
  • The Nature of Suffering: The​ series poses ⁤profound‍ questions about the role of ⁢suffering in ‍personal growth and the ⁣creation ‌of meaning.

Character Evolution: ‌The Heartbeat of a Complex Story

The finale​ of⁣ HBO’s ‘Westworld’ weaves a tapestry of intricate character⁣ arcs,⁢ showcasing‌ the struggles of sentience, identity, and evolution. The journey ‌of the hosts from​ mere machines to‌ beings⁢ capable of⁣ profound emotional experiences serves as ‌a microcosm of​ the human condition. Over four seasons, we ⁢witnessed characters transforming in⁤ ways that ⁤blur the lines between creator ⁣and creation, leading to moral​ dilemmas that ⁢challenge our perception of ‌what it truly ⁣means ‌to be‍ ‘alive.’ Each‍ character’s evolution was not⁢ just pivotal to ‌the ⁤plot but also ‌reflected deeper​ philosophical questions, inviting the audience to engage in introspection.

Key‍ characters displayed significant⁤ growth, often facing existential crises that​ mirrored‌ the complexities of human ‍relationships and⁢ societal constructs. Below is ⁣a glimpse of the‌ major transformations:

Character Initial State Final State
Dolores Naïve Host Empowered⁢ Leader
Maeve Subservient Host Independent Force
Bernard Conflicted Creator Self-Aware Guardian
William (Man in Black) Determined Control Haunted by Choices
